The U.S. Transportation Security Administration or TSA will require a federally compliant driver license, identification card or another acceptable form of identification (such as a US passport or military ID) to fly within the U.S. The compliant ID takes the place of a standard driver’s license. When renewing a license at the Bureau of Motor Vehicles, Ohioans can ask for the Real ID and to save lives through the Ohio Donor Registry!
